| /// \brief Multiplies corresponding pairs of packed 8-bit unsigned integer
 | |
| ///    values contained in the first source operand and packed 8-bit signed
 | |
| ///    integer values contained in the second source operand, adds pairs of
 | |
| ///    contiguous products with signed saturation, and writes the 16-bit sums to
 | |
| ///    the corresponding bits in the destination. For example, bits [7:0] of
 | |
| ///    both operands are multiplied, bits [15:8] of both operands are
 | |
| ///    multiplied, and the sum of both results is written to bits [15:0] of the
 | |
| ///    destination.
 | |
| ///
 | |
| /// \headerfile <x86intrin.h>
 | |
| ///
 | |
| /// This intrinsic corresponds to the \c VPMADDUBSW instruction.
 | |
| ///
 | |
| /// \param __a
 | |
| ///    A 128-bit integer vector containing the first source operand.
 | |
| /// \param __b
 | |
| ///    A 128-bit integer vector containing the second source operand.
 | |
| /// \returns A 128-bit integer vector containing the sums of products of both
 | |
| ///    operands: \n
 | |
| ///    \a R0 := (\a __a0 * \a __b0) + (\a __a1 * \a __b1) \n
 | |
| ///    \a R1 := (\a __a2 * \a __b2) + (\a __a3 * \a __b3) \n
 | |
| ///    \a R2 := (\a __a4 * \a __b4) + (\a __a5 * \a __b5) \n
 | |
| ///    \a R3 := (\a __a6 * \a __b6) + (\a __a7 * \a __b7) \n
 | |
| ///    \a R4 := (\a __a8 * \a __b8) + (\a __a9 * \a __b9) \n
 | |
| ///    \a R5 := (\a __a10 * \a __b10) + (\a __a11 * \a __b11) \n
 | |
| ///    \a R6 := (\a __a12 * \a __b12) + (\a __a13 * \a __b13) \n
 | |
| ///    \a R7 := (\a __a14 * \a __b14) + (\a __a15 * \a __b15)
 | |
| static __inline__ __m128i __DEFAULT_FN_ATTRS
 | |
| _mm_maddubs_epi16(__m128i __a, __m128i __b)
 | |
| {
 | |
|     return (__m128i)__builtin_ia32_pmaddubsw128((__v16qi)__a, (__v16qi)__b);
 | |
| }

| /// \brief Copies the 8-bit integers from a 128-bit integer vector to the
 | |
| ///    destination or clears 8-bit values in the destination, as specified by
 | |
| ///    the second source operand.
 | |
| ///
 | |
| /// \headerfile <x86intrin.h>
 | |
| ///
 | |
| /// This intrinsic corresponds to the \c VPSHUFB instruction.
 | |
| ///
 | |
| /// \param __a
 | |
| ///    A 128-bit integer vector containing the values to be copied.
 | |
| /// \param __b
 | |
| ///    A 128-bit integer vector containing control bytes corresponding to
 | |
| ///    positions in the destination:
 | |
| ///    Bit 7: \n
 | |
| ///    1: Clear the corresponding byte in the destination. \n
 | |
| ///    0: Copy the selected source byte to the corresponding byte in the
 | |
| ///    destination. \n
 | |
| ///    Bits [6:4] Reserved.  \n
 | |
| ///    Bits [3:0] select the source byte to be copied.
 | |
| /// \returns A 128-bit integer vector containing the copied or cleared values.
 | |
| static __inline__ __m128i __DEFAULT_FN_ATTRS
 | |
| _mm_shuffle_epi8(__m128i __a, __m128i __b)
 | |
| {
 | |
|     return (__m128i)__builtin_ia32_pshufb128((__v16qi)__a, (__v16qi)__b);
 | |
| }

| /// \brief For each 8-bit integer in the first source operand, perform one of
 | |
| ///    the following actions as specified by the second source operand: If the
 | |
| ///    byte in the second source is negative, calculate the two's complement of
 | |
| ///    the corresponding byte in the first source, and write that value to the
 | |
| ///    destination. If the byte in the second source is positive, copy the
 | |
| ///    corresponding byte from the first source to the destination. If the byte
 | |
| ///    in the second source is zero, clear the corresponding byte in the
 | |
| ///    destination.
 | |
| ///
 | |
| /// \headerfile <x86intrin.h>
 | |
| ///
 | |
| /// This intrinsic corresponds to the \c VPSIGNB instruction.
 | |
| ///
 | |
| /// \param __a
 | |
| ///    A 128-bit integer vector containing the values to be copied.
 | |
| /// \param __b
 | |
| ///    A 128-bit integer vector containing control bytes corresponding to
 | |
| ///    positions in the destination.
 | |
| /// \returns A 128-bit integer vector containing the resultant values.
 | |
| static __inline__ __m128i __DEFAULT_FN_ATTRS
 | |
| _mm_sign_epi8(__m128i __a, __m128i __b)
 | |
| {
 | |
|     return (__m128i)__builtin_ia32_psignb128((__v16qi)__a, (__v16qi)__b);
 | |
| }
